Форум русскоязычного сообщества Ubuntu


Увидели сообщение с непонятной ссылкой, спам, непристойность или оскорбление?
Воспользуйтесь ссылкой «Сообщить модератору» рядом с сообщением!

Автор Тема: crone для юзера в домене [РЕШЕНО]  (Прочитано 1756 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н Elaugaste

  • Автор темы
  • Новичок
  • *
  • Сообщений: 35
    • Просмотр профиля
crone для юзера в домене [РЕШЕНО]
« : 01 Апреля 2011, 06:27:34 »
Здравствуйте форумчане :)
очень нужна ваша помощь

есть Ubuntu 10.10 она заведена в домен Win 2003 (завел так(https://help.ubuntu.ru/wiki/%D0%B2%D0%B2%D0%BE%D0%B4_%D0%B2_%D0%B4%D0%BE%D0%BC%D0%B5%D0%BD_windows))
на ней стоит скрипт который должен выполняться в 10 утра каждый день...
долго не мог понять почему то срабатывает то нет
посмотрел лог :

sudo cat /var/log/cron.log
Apr  1 11:02:57 admin cron[1194]: (CRON) STARTUP (fork ok)
Apr  1 11:02:57 admin cron[1194]: (elaugaste) ORPHAN (no passwd entry)
Apr  1 11:02:57 admin cron[1194]: (CRON) INFO (Running @reboot jobs)

Погуглил "ORPHAN (no passwd entry)"
прочитал что крон не видит юзера "_http://www.opennet.ru/openforum/vsluhforumID10/2709.html"

долго думал вспомнил про порядок загрузки ...
перечитал статью о вводе в домен ...

sudo bash -c "for i in 2 3 4 5; do mv /etc/rc$i.d/S20winbind /etc/rc$i.d/S99winbind; done"
прокурил статью  _http://www.opennet.ru/base/sys/run_services_tips.txt.html
решил что cron должен запускаться после winbind`a  дабы видел доменных юзеров
sudo bash -c for i in 2 3 4 5; do mv /etc/rc$i.d/S99winbind /etc/rc$i.d/S98winbind; done
sudo bash -c "for i in 2 3 4 5; do mv /etc/rc$i.d/S20cron /etc/rc$i.d/S99cron; done"

все бы отлично но cron  упорно не желает признавать существование в системе доменного юзера
getent passwd  юзеров показывает

возможно я не правильно понял про порядок загрузки ...
но вроде правильно

помогите плз :)


Пользователь решил продолжить мысль [time]Fri Apr  1 07:45:43 2011[/time]:
Все тему можно закрывать ...
переставил винбинд на 97 уровень загрузки вырубил крон из автозапуска и вписал его в rc.local  
sleep 5
service crone restart
#Имено через рестарт ... обычным стартом не видит
Костыль ^_@
но цель достигнута

sudo cat /var/log/cron.log
Apr  1 12:39:26 admin cron[1142]: (CRON) INFO (pidfile fd = 3)
Apr  1 12:39:26 admin cron[1153]: (CRON) STARTUP (fork ok)
Apr  1 12:39:26 admin cron[1153]: (elaugaste) ORPHAN (no passwd entry)
Apr  1 12:39:26 admin cron[1153]: (CRON) INFO (Running @reboot jobs)
Apr  1 12:39:37 admin cron[1496]: (CRON) INFO (pidfile fd = 3)
Apr  1 12:39:37 admin cron[1497]: (CRON) STARTUP (fork ok)
Apr  1 12:39:37 admin cron[1497]: (CRON) INFO (Skipping @reboot jobs -- not system startup)
« Последнее редактирование: 07 Апреля 2011, 22:30:39 от RustemNur »

 

Страница сгенерирована за 0.014 секунд. Запросов: 20.